Timothy A. Long is an experienced professional in the fields of fashion, museum curatorship, and social media, currently serving as the Director of Museum Business Development and Corporate Client Services at Hindman Auctions. Previously, Timothy held positions at the Museum of London as the Curator of Fashion & Decorative Arts and in social media, and served as a Graduate Intern at Alexander McQueen. Additionally, Timothy has extensive experience at the Chicago History Museum, where roles included Curator of Costumes, Costume Collection Manager, and Costume Collection Intern, as well as serving as a Guest Curator at the San Diego History Center. Educational accomplishments include a Master’s degree in the History and Culture of Fashion from the London College of Fashion and a Bachelor's degree in Fashion/Apparel Design from the International Academy of Design and Technology-Chicago.

Hindman Auctions

Hindman is a leading fine art auction house connecting cities nationwide to the global art market. With offices and salerooms throughout the country, Hindman conducts over 140 auctions annually in all major fine art and luxury collecting categories, while offering buyers and sellers an exceptional experience across multiple selling channels and price points. Hindman’s team of experts is dedicated to maintaining the highest standards of ethics and integrity in the industry. Driven by this client-first approach, Hindman provides collectors, fiduciaries, and institutions with a comprehensive suite of services including auctions, appraisals, private sales, and art advisory. Hindman was formed through the merger of two premier auction houses, Leslie Hindman Auctioneers (est. 1982) and Cowan’s Auctions (est. 1995). Celebrating its 40th Anniversary in 2022, Hindman has established itself as a market leader by providing outstanding service and achieving record results. Hindman is headquartered in Chicago with 15 additional locations serving clients coast to coast. With industry-leading technology, over $100 million in annual sales, and a team of 175 experienced professionals, Hindman is well positioned to handle a range of auction and appraisal projects. Hindman conducts over 100 auctions a year in categories such as fine jewelry, fine art, modern design, fine books and manuscripts, furniture, decorative arts, couture, Asian works of art, arts of the American west, numismatics, and more.
